CDR MPC Student Self Releases First Single on Spotify

Thomas Drew, a student at CDR’s MPC project, has just self-released his first single on Spotify titled I Like This.

Recorded during a period of self isolation during the pandemic, the composition is an acoustic guitar driven pop track that is reminiscent of early Jamie T and Darwin Deez. We are very proud to see how Thomas has developed while being part of MPC and can’t wait to hear more of what he has to offer!
